Distribution and Popularity

The surname Medlin has a relatively widespread distribution, with the highest incidence found in the United States. According to data, the Medlin surname is most prevalent in the US, with a total of 14,718 individuals bearing this surname. This indicates a strong presence of the Medlin family in American society, reflecting the diverse and dynamic nature of the country's population.

Other countries where the Medlin surname is prominent include Australia, England, the Dominican Republic, Germany, and Mexico, among others.
